I guess I'm headed out your way next week to show the boys and my wife some god ole Nebraska scenery. We are thinking of staying the night near Chadron, maybe at Fort Robinson. We (I) would like to stop at toadstool park and maybe the fur trappers museum. Anything else we should stop and see(old tractors)? Long story short we are going out on Hwy 20 and then up to the black hills and back on I90 in SD.

That fur trappers museum is something. The biggest collection of trade guns I have ever seen, plus lots of other stuff. We were there in 2010.
 
I remember the furr trappers museum as a kid, and walking past all those glass cases of muskets of all different makes and models. I was in heaven, back when I still wanted to be a mountain man. That plan got put on hold until beaver prices go back up!

So Called world larges drug store..Wall drugs along there somewhere. My daughter had told us we had to stop..Mid afternoon went in for what we planned a 20 minute break. Think we wondred around for over two hours.. Lots to see in that part of the country. I was just there a mth ago. On the way to Mt R drive thru bear world.
Also Badlands out by Wall is great to see. Watch out at teh observation places though. Rattlesnake warnings.
